1. Soak Up the Sun at Florida’s Beautiful Beaches
One of the best ways to relax before your cruise is to spend some time on Florida’s pristine beaches. Each port city boasts its own unique coastal charm, making it easy to find a beach that suits your relaxation needs.
In Miami, South Beach is famous for its white sand and crystal-clear waters. The beach’s vibrant atmosphere, coupled with its iconic art deco architecture, makes it a great spot for lounging under the sun or taking a leisurely stroll along the boardwalk. If you prefer a quieter experience, Key Biscayne offers a more serene beach environment with less crowding and beautiful views of the Miami skyline.
Further north, Clearwater Beach near Tampa is known for its soft, white sand and calm, shallow waters. It’s ideal for a relaxing day in the sun or a sunset walk along the pier. Each beach offers its own blend of relaxation and scenic beauty, perfect for unwinding before your cruise.
2. Explore Scenic Parks and Nature Reserves
Florida’s natural beauty extends beyond its beaches, with numerous parks and nature reserves providing peaceful settings for relaxation. Near Port Canaveral, Cocoa Beach offers not only beautiful sands but also access to nearby natural areas like Canova Beach Park and Cherie Down Park, where you can enjoy scenic trails and lush greenery.
Tampa’s Bayshore Boulevard is another excellent spot for relaxation. This picturesque promenade offers stunning views of Tampa Bay, perfect for a leisurely walk or bike ride. The adjacent Tampa Riverwalk provides a scenic route along the waterfront with parks, cafes, and beautiful cityscape views.
In Miami, the Vizcaya Museum and Gardens offers a tranquil escape with its historic estate and beautifully landscaped gardens. Wandering through the lush grounds and enjoying the serene environment is a great way to relax and take in some local history and culture.

4. Visit Local Aquariums for a Calming Experience
If you’re looking for a peaceful yet engaging activity, consider visiting one of the many aquariums in Florida. These attractions provide a calming atmosphere where you can observe marine life and learn about ocean conservation.
The Florida Aquarium in Tampa offers a serene environment where you can explore exhibits showcasing marine ecosystems from coral reefs to mangroves. The aquarium’s tranquil atmosphere, combined with its educational exhibits, makes it a great place to unwind and connect with nature.
In Miami, the Miami Seaquarium offers a similar relaxing experience with its various marine animal exhibits and interactive shows. Watching sea creatures glide through their habitats can be both soothing and captivating, providing a peaceful pre-cruise activity.
5. Enjoy a Relaxing Cruise Tour
Before your cruise departs, you might want to consider taking a relaxing boat tour or sightseeing cruise. Many Florida ports offer scenic cruises that allow you to enjoy the local waterways and cityscapes in a leisurely manner.
In Fort Lauderdale, known for its extensive canal system, a scenic boat tour is an ideal way to relax and take in the city’s picturesque views. The Water Taxi offers a relaxing way to explore Fort Lauderdale’s canals and waterfront areas, with stops at various attractions and dining options along the way.
Similarly, in Miami, a scenic cruise around Biscayne Bay provides stunning views of the city skyline, luxury waterfront homes, and beautiful natural landscapes. These tours offer a peaceful way to unwind and enjoy the local scenery before embarking on your main cruise adventure.
6. Stroll Through Charming Local Neighborhoods
Exploring charming local neighborhoods can also be a relaxing way to spend your time before your cruise. Florida’s port cities are home to vibrant districts with unique shops, cafes, and cultural attractions.
In St. Petersburg, the Downtown Arts District offers a blend of galleries, boutiques, and cafes. A leisurely stroll through this area provides opportunities to enjoy local art, grab a coffee, and soak in the city’s creative atmosphere.
Miami’s Wynwood Walls is another excellent destination for a relaxed exploration. This outdoor street art museum features colorful murals and graffiti from renowned artists. Wandering through the district and appreciating the art can be a calming and enjoyable way to spend your time.
7. Dine at Relaxing Waterfront Restaurants
For a laid-back dining experience with beautiful views, consider visiting one of the many waterfront restaurants near Florida’s ports. These venues offer not only delicious food but also a relaxing atmosphere to enjoy your meal.
Miami’s Joe’s Stone Crab is a renowned seafood restaurant offering fresh catches and a picturesque setting overlooking the water. The relaxed ambiance, combined with its delectable cuisine, makes it a great spot for a pre-cruise meal.
In Tampa, Ulele provides a unique dining experience with a focus on native-inspired cuisine. Located along the Tampa Riverwalk, the restaurant offers beautiful views of the river and a tranquil setting perfect for a relaxing meal.
